Description and Introduction

Field-Programmable Gate Arrays The **OR2T40A-6PS208** is a high-performance programmable logic device (PLD) designed for complex digital circuit applications. As part of the ORCA® Series 2 family, this component offers a balance of speed, density, and flexibility, making it suitable for telecommunications, networking, and embedded systems.  

Featuring **40,000 usable gates**, the OR2T40A-6PS208 operates at a **6ns pin-to-pin delay**, ensuring efficient signal processing. Its **208-pin plastic quad flat pack (PQFP) package** provides a compact yet robust solution for surface-mount PCB designs. The device supports **in-system programmability (ISP)**, allowing for convenient field updates without removing it from the circuit board.  

With built-in **programmable I/O standards**, including LVTTL and LVCMOS, the OR2T40A-6PS208 ensures compatibility with various logic levels. It also includes dedicated **clock management resources**, enabling precise timing control in synchronous designs.  

Engineers favor this PLD for its **low power consumption** and **high reliability**, making it ideal for mission-critical applications. Whether used in data routing, signal processing, or control systems, the OR2T40A-6PS208 delivers a scalable and efficient solution for modern digital designs.
